Errori, bug, domande - pagina 2789

 

Domanda su TimeLocal().

Non è l'unico però.

Il fatto è che quando si esegue lo script che allena i moduli NS, ho notato che a volte il modulo impiega molto tempo per allenarsi. Non molto bello, ma comprensibile.

Così ho deciso di aggiungere un semplice calcolo del tempo necessario per ogni iterazione.

E poi ho avuto alcune domande...

Comunque, la formazione del modulo inizia

2020.06.27 14:47:03.435 modul_training_mZZ3_MLP (EURUSD,H3)     ~~~ Сеть №16 по модулю >>> 11 (24) <<< создана... Учимся...

E poi vedo che ci vuole molto tempo per allenarsi.

Poi ricevo messaggi

2020.06.27 14:47:05.038 modul_training_mZZ3_MLP (EURUSD,H3)     Ошибка = 3.03%
2020.06.27 14:47:05.038 modul_training_mZZ3_MLP (EURUSD,H3)     00:00:02 ~~~~~~~~~~~~~~~~~~~~~~~~~~~~

Non c'è niente di cui lamentarsi nelle registrazioni. Due secondi. Ma in realtà ho aspettato 5 minuti, se non di più, per queste voci.

Il computer non è caricato con nient'altro. Dove cercare il tiratore?


Mentre scrivevo questo, il modulo successivo veniva insegnato. Lì, sembrava scrivere normalmente...

2020.06.27 14:59:15.114 modul_training_mZZ3_MLP (EURUSD,H3)     Ошибка = 3.03%
2020.06.27 14:59:15.114 modul_training_mZZ3_MLP (EURUSD,H3)     00:12:09 ~~~~~~~~~~~~~~~~~~~~~~~~~~~~
 
Il timer non funziona quando il mercato è chiuso. È normale?
 
Buon pomeriggio, ho pagato per l'EA, ma per qualche motivo non appare negli acquisti e nel terminale, per favore consigliatemi cosa fare?
 
Vladimir Karputov:

Il commercio disattivato è la risposta.

Sinossi:Permesso di commercio

Grazie, ma non c'è nulla nel testo sul Commercio disattivato
 
Turbo888:
Grazie, ma il testo non dice nulla sul Commercio disattivato

Esegui lo script di aiuto. Usate Google Translator per tradurre i messaggi di servizio.

File:
 
Turbo888:
Grazie, ma il testo non dice nulla sul Commercio disattivato

Il tuo messaggio:

Forum sul trading, sistemi di trading automatico e test di strategie di trading

Bug, bug, domande

Turbo888, 2020.06.26 22:08

Buona giornata. La piattaforma MT5 non permette il trading per qualche motivo. Ieri c'era uno scambio, oggi non c'è nessuno scambio. E questo su due cruscotti diversi. Le fermate e le acquisizioni non sono mostrate. Nel mio diario dice: failed buy limit 1 MESU20 at 3015.75 sl: 3013.75 [Trade disabled] Cosa c'è di sbagliato?

Messaggio dal sistema:

"fallito acquisto limite 1 MESU20 a 3015.75 sl: 3013.75[trade disabilitato]"

 

Aiutatemi, non capisco cosa sta succedendo. Quando si copiano i dati storici, l'elemento 0 dell'array è sempre uguale al 1°. Cioè il 1° ha il prezzo di chiusura, qui è corretto, ma lo zero ha il prezzo di apertura, non quello di chiusura.

if (CopyRates(symbol[symbol_idx], _Period, 0, BAR_KOL_MIN, mql_rates) < 0)
        alert(symbol[symbol_idx] + " не удалось скопировать исторические данные.");
else   // если скопировали исторические данные
{
        if (mql_rates[0].time == D'2015.01.19 11:00')
        {
                Print("0 " + TimeToString(mql_rates[0].time) + " " + DoubleToString(mql_rates[0].close));
                Print("1 " + TimeToString(mql_rates[1].time) + " " + DoubleToString(mql_rates[1].close));
                Print("2 " + TimeToString(mql_rates[2].time) + " " + DoubleToString(mql_rates[2].close));
                Print("3 " + TimeToString(mql_rates[3].time) + " " + DoubleToString(mql_rates[3].close));
                Print("4 " + TimeToString(mql_rates[4].time) + " " + DoubleToString(mql_rates[4].close));
        }

2015.01.19 11:00:00 0 2015.01.19 11:00 1.15834000

2015.01.19 11:00:00 1 2015.01.19 10:00 1.15834000

2015.01.19 11:00:00 2 2015.01.19 09:00 1.15587000

2015.01.19 11:00:00 3 2015.01.19 08:00 1.15678000

2015.01.19 11:00:00 4 2015.01.19 07:00 1.15605000

Questo non è lo stesso prezzo di chiusura sulle barre mentre accade. L'ho controllato sul grafico.
 
progeon:

Aiutatemi, non capisco cosa sta succedendo. Quando si copiano i dati storici, l'elemento 0 dell'array è sempre uguale al 1°. Cioè il 1° ha il prezzo di chiusura, qui è corretto, ma lo zero ha il prezzo di apertura, non quello di chiusura.

2015.01.19 11:00:00 0 2015.01.19 11:00 1.15834000

2015.01.19 11:00:00 1 2015.01.19 10:00 1.15834000

2015.01.19 11:00:00 2 2015.01.19 09:00 1.15587000

2015.01.19 11:00:00 3 2015.01.19 08:00 1.15678000

2015.01.19 11:00:00 4 2015.01.19 07:00 1.15605000

Questo non è lo stesso prezzo di chiusura sulle barre mentre accade. L'ho confrontato con la tabella.

Dove sta accadendo questo? Forse nel tester in modalità prezzo aperto?

 
Stanislav Korotky:

Dove avviene? Forse nel tester in modalità prezzo aperto?

Ho capito, nel tester, ma copio quando si apre una nuova barra. Cioè la 0a barra (quella attuale) ha appena iniziato a formarsi e quindi ha un prezzo di apertura.

 
L'errore di installazione del software acquistato ha iniziato ad apparire sul mercato:

1. Quando si imposta per la prima volta la demo per il tester, questa appare nel tester.
2. Poi lo si affitta o lo si compra.
3. Dopo di che nel terminale si preme install
4. E non succede niente. Nessun errore viene registrato. Solo che non succede niente.


Soluzione: disinstalla la versione demo dal Navigator Market e installa di nuovo la versione a noleggio.
È molto difficile per i nuovi arrivati.